Presenting content items and performing actions with respect to content items

    公开(公告)号:US11775152B2

    公开(公告)日:2023-10-03

    申请号:US17543370

    申请日:2021-12-06

    Applicant: Google LLC

    CPC classification number: G06F3/04842 G06F3/0482 H04L67/12 H04L67/75

    Abstract: A method for presenting content items includes receiving, by a first user device, a request for a video item hosted by a content platform, and providing a graphical user interface comprising a first portion having a first media player to playback the requested video item and a second portion having a second media player to playback an additional video item of a plurality of additional video items. The requested video item comprises a plurality of portions, each associated with a corresponding portion of the additional video item based on a set of actions that were performed by a second user interacting with the corresponding portion of the additional video item. The method further includes in response to an interaction of the first user with respect to a portion of the additional video item, causing the playback of the requested video item to pause.

    Transitioning between prior dialog contexts with automated assistants

    公开(公告)号:US11727220B2

    公开(公告)日:2023-08-15

    申请号:US17700994

    申请日:2022-03-22

    Applicant: GOOGLE LLC

    Abstract: Techniques are described related to prior context retrieval with an automated assistant. In various implementations, instance(s) of free-form natural language input received from a user during a human-to-computer dialog session between the user and an automated assistant may be used to generate a first dialog context. The first dialog context may include intent(s) and slot value(s) associated with the intent(s). Similar operations may be performed with additional inputs to generate a second dialog context that is semantically distinct from the first dialog context. When a command is received from the user to transition the automated assistant back to the first dialog context, natural language output may be generated that conveys at least one or more of the intents of the first dialog context and one or more of the slot values of the first dialog context. This natural language output may be presented to the user.

    CROSS-APPLICATION CONTENT PLAYER
    165.
    发明公开

    公开(公告)号:US20230161469A1

    公开(公告)日:2023-05-25

    申请号:US18094964

    申请日:2023-01-09

    Applicant: Google LLC

    Abstract: A method includes receiving, during playback of a content item in a content player of a first mobile application presented on a client device of a first user, an indication of a user request pertaining to a second mobile application, the user request corresponding to a first point in the content item played in the content player of the first mobile application. The method additionally includes causing the playback of the content item to continue in the content player presented on a client device while a user interface of the second mobile application is displayed on the client device, wherein the content player persists on top of the user interface of the second mobile application to provide the playback of the content item in a continuous manner from the first point in the content item. The method further includes causing the content item to be shared with a second user in response to an input event initiating sharing of the content item, the input event following a user interaction by the first user with the content player persisting on top of the user interface of the second mobile application.

    Dynamic sequence-based adjustment of prompt generation

    公开(公告)号:US11640822B2

    公开(公告)日:2023-05-02

    申请号:US16943559

    申请日:2020-07-30

    Applicant: Google LLC

    Abstract: Systems and methods for dynamic sequence-based adjustment of prompt generation are provided. The system can receive a first interaction and a second interaction via a client device and identify a first sequence based on the first interaction and the second interaction. The system can map the first sequence to a node data structure and identify a node in the node data structure that matches the first sequence. The system can generate an adjusted parameter for a first digital component object responsive to a match with an attribute of the node in the node data structure. The system can execute a real-time digital component selection process among a plurality of digital component objects including the first digital component object to select the first digital component object. The system can transmit a prompt with the first digital component object to a client device to cause the client device to present the prompt.

    METHODS, SYSTEMS, AND MEDIA FOR GENERATING CONTEXTUALLY RELEVANT MESSAGES

    公开(公告)号:US20230090161A1

    公开(公告)日:2023-03-23

    申请号:US17994948

    申请日:2022-11-28

    Applicant: Google LLC

    Abstract: Methods, systems, and media for generating contextually relevant messages are provided. In some embodiments, a method for generating contextually relevant messages is provided, the method comprising: requesting content from a content source; receiving a content item; causing the content item to be presented using a display device; causing an endorsement indication corresponding to an endorsing user to be concurrently presented with the content item, wherein a user associated with the request for content and the endorsing user are social connections; receiving user input selecting the endorsement indication; causing a temporary messaging interface including a temporary message from the user to the endorsing user to be presented; causing a permanent message to be created based on the temporary message and received user input; and causing the permanent message to be presented to the endorsing user.

    System and interface that facilitate selecting videos to share in a messaging application

    公开(公告)号:US11588767B2

    公开(公告)日:2023-02-21

    申请号:US17062874

    申请日:2020-10-05

    Applicant: Google LLC

    Abstract: Systems and methods are provided that facilitate selecting videos to share in a messaging session such as group video chat. In one or more aspects, a system is provided that includes an interface component configured to generate a graphical user interface that facilitates selecting by a user of the device, one or more videos provided by a remote streaming media provider, for sharing with one or more other users in association with a messaging session between the user and the one or more other users, the interface comprising a plurality of input categories including at least one video selection category corresponding to information identifying a set of videos associated with a shared attribute. The system further includes a presentation component configured to display the graphical user interface via a display screen of the device in response to a request.

    Systems and methods for stateless maintenance of a remote state machine

    公开(公告)号:US11573843B2

    公开(公告)日:2023-02-07

    申请号:US16322458

    申请日:2017-01-27

    Applicant: Google LLC

    Abstract: Systems and methods of implementing a finite-state machine using electronic notifications delivered to a client device in a computer networking environment are provided. A content item can be received, along with first and second notifications associated with the content item. The first and second notifications can be stored in a queue. In some implementations, a state machine can be maintained in which at least some states may cause the first or second notifications to be displayed, and in which transitional conditions between states may depend at least in part on user interaction with the displayed notifications.

    GENERATING DEEPLINKS FOR APPLICATIONS BASED ON MULTI-LEVEL REFERRER DATA

    公开(公告)号:US20230008181A1

    公开(公告)日:2023-01-12

    申请号:US17944179

    申请日:2022-09-13

    Applicant: GOOGLE LLC

    Abstract: Systems and methods for providing referrer data to an application are provided. One method includes receiving a first set of data packets indicating a command to navigate from a first resource to a second resource. The first set of data packets identifies the first resource and secondary referrer data associated with the first resource or a first content item on the first resource. The method includes rendering the second resource and a second content item provided within the second resource. The method includes receiving a selection of the second content item. The method includes generating a second set of data packets including the secondary referrer data and primary referrer data associated with the second resource or the second content item. The method includes transmitting the second set of data packets to a server, receiving a deeplink generated by the server, and rendering a content interface using the deeplink.

Patent Agency Ranking